First off, let’s talk about SD-WAN (Software-Defined Wide Area Networking). Think of SD-WAN as the turbocharger of your networking engine. It optimizes traffic flow, enhances application performance, and significantly reduces costs associated with traditional WAN architecture. By leveraging multiple connection types—such as MPLS, LTE, or broadband—SD-WAN ensures that data travels the most efficient route available, akin to a pit crew ensuring that a racing vehicle is always performing at V8 levels. However, while SD-WAN can significantly improve your network's agility, it’s crucial to remember that speed without security can lead to disaster. This is where firewalls come into play. Firewalls act as the first line of defense in your network architecture, serving as a robust barrier against external threats. A modern firewall should be more than just a gatekeeper; it needs to be an intelligent, adaptive security solution capable of analyzing traffic in real-time and making instant decisions. To maximize the effectiveness of your firewalls, consider implementing a layered security approach. Just as a multi-stage racing strategy involves different tactics for each lap, your network security should incorporate various layers—application firewalls, intrusion detection systems, and endpoint security solutions—to create a comprehensive shield against potential breaches. Regularly update and configure your firewall rules to adapt to new threats, and ensure your team conducts periodic assessments to evaluate the effectiveness of your network security measures. Now, let’s shift gears and talk about routing. In networking, routing is like the navigation system in a car; it determines the best paths for data to travel across the network. Effective routing ensures that your data packets reach their destinations quickly and efficiently, reducing latency and improving overall performance. One of the best practices in routing is to implement dynamic routing protocols, such as OSPF or BGP, which can automatically adjust routes based on current network conditions. This adaptability is akin to a driver adjusting their speed and trajectory based on real-time race conditions. Moreover, monitoring your routing performance is crucial. Use network monitoring tools to track performance metrics and identify potential bottlenecks before they become critical issues. Just as a race team analyzes telemetry data to fine-tune their vehicle, your IT team should be closely monitoring network performance to ensure maximum efficiency.
